zoukankan      html  css  js  c++  java
  • Oracle定义常量和变量

    转:

    Oracle定义常量和变量

    1.定义变量

    变量指的就是可变化的量,程序运行过程中可以随时改变其数据存储结构

    标准语法格式:
    <变量名><数据类型>[(长度):=<初始值>]

    示例:

    复制代码
    declare
    v_name varchar2(100):='JACK';----定义的一个name变量,并且赋予初始值
    begin 
    v_name:='张三';
    dbms_output.put_line('name变量的值为:'||v_name);
    end;
    复制代码

    输出结果为:

    name变量的值为:张三

    2.定义常量

    常量指的是不会变化的量,例如一年四个季度,9月有30天,圆周率等

    语法格式:

    <常量名>constant<数据类型>:=<常量值>;

    示例:

    <1>错误代码:

    复制代码
    declare
    september_day constant integer:=30;----定义的一个name变量,并且赋予初始值
    begin 
    september_day:=29;
    dbms_output.put_line('september_day变量的值为:'||september_day);
    end;
    复制代码

    报错为:

    常量是不可以进行赋值的;

    正确代码:

    declare
    september_day constant integer:=30;----定义的一个name变量,并且赋予初始值
    begin 
    dbms_output.put_line('september_day变量的值为:'||september_day);
    end;

    输出结果为:

    september_day变量的值为:30

    作者:OLIVER

    -------------------------------------------

    个性签名:八德:勤、俭、刚、明、忠、恕、谦、浑

    如果觉得这篇文章对你有小小的帮助的话,记得在右下角点个“推荐”哦,博主在此感谢!

    分类: Oracle
  • 相关阅读:
    HDU 4472 Count DP题
    HDU 1878 欧拉回路 图论
    CSUST 1503 ZZ买衣服
    HDU 2085 核反应堆
    HDU 1029 Ignatius and the Princess IV
    UVa 11462 Age Sort
    UVa 11384
    UVa 11210
    LA 3401
    解决学一会儿累了的问题
  • 原文地址:https://www.cnblogs.com/libin6505/p/11726870.html
Copyright © 2011-2022 走看看